One of the key advantages of industrial foam products is their ability to cushion and protect fragile items during transportation and handling. Foam packaging materials, such as foam inserts and padding, are commonly used in the shipping and logistics industry to safeguard delicate goods from damage. These foam products are designed to absorb shock and vibration, ensuring that items arrive at their destination intact. Whether it’s electronic devices, glassware, or automotive parts, foam packaging materials provide a reliable and cost-effective solution for protecting valuable products.
In addition to their protective qualities, industrial foam products also offer excellent insulation properties. Foam insulation materials are used in construction and HVAC systems to regulate temperature, reduce energy consumption, and improve indoor air quality. Foam insulation can be applied to walls, roofs, and floors to create a barrier against heat transfer, keeping buildings cool in the summer and warm in the winter. By enhancing thermal efficiency, foam insulation helps reduce heating and cooling costs, making it a sustainable choice for eco-conscious consumers and businesses.

industrial foam products come in various forms, including foam sheets, rolls, and custom-molded shapes to meet specific requirements. Foam sheets are versatile and can be easily cut, shaped, and manipulated to fit different applications. They are commonly used in packaging, cushioning, and arts and crafts projects. Foam rolls are ideal for wrapping and protecting large items or irregularly shaped objects. Custom-molded foam products are tailored to the dimensions and specifications of a particular project, providing a precise and tailored solution for unique applications.
The use of industrial foam products extends beyond packaging and insulation to a wide range of industries, including automotive, aerospace, healthcare, and sports equipment manufacturing. In the automotive sector, foam components are used in car interiors, seating, and soundproofing materials to enhance comfort and reduce noise. In aerospace applications, foam products are incorporated into aircraft interiors, seating, and insulation to improve safety and performance. In healthcare settings, foam mattresses, cushions, and medical devices are designed to provide comfort, support, and pressure relief for patients. In sports equipment manufacturing, foam padding and protective gear are essential for preventing injuries and maximizing performance.
